Excelsior first started out under the name Death and Glory, when the band lead singer and songwriter decided to write his first song with his friend for a small competition they were trying to start with their brothers. Being encouraged from the outcome of the one song, they continued writing.
Starting to write under the name Death and Glory, they produced multiple songs but didn't have the funds to record them. Soon Death and Glory began writing and recording at home. Changing the band name to a much more fitting title, Excelsior released their first two songs "Irony" and "Into the Fire" to Youtube in April of 2013.
